IAEA, Iran confirm joint trust, cooperation


(MENAFN) Iran and the International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A) shared a mutual report in which they both “reaffirmed the spirit of cooperation and mutual trust”.

The report was when IAEA Director General Rafael Grossi and Mohammad Eslami, the new chief of the Atomic Energy Organization of Iran (AEOI), arranged discussion in Tehran early Sunday.

During the report, IAEA and Iran identified the requires to discuss “the relevant issues in a constructive atmosphere and exclusively in a technical manner.”

The assembly was one day before the IAEA Board of Governors gather in Vienna, the Iran nuclear agenda is one of the subjects on the program of the board.
